Your best location runs differently from your worst — and the difference isn't the market, it's the manager. The operational instincts, local adaptations, hiring judgment, and customer relationship skills that make one location thrive are invisible to headquarters and impossible to replicate through SOPs alone. A Know-How Library captures the operational wisdom of your best managers and makes it available across every location — so your newest franchise doesn't spend two years learning what your best location figured out on day one.

Knowledge at Risk

"The regional manager who knows that Location 12 needs to staff up two weeks before the college semester starts, that the downtown location's HVAC system needs a specific workaround in July, and why the supplier who looks cheapest on paper costs you more in returns — that operational intelligence has never been shared systematically."
